Market Size and Trends

The Aerospace and Defense MRO Market is estimated to be valued at USD 86.5 billion in 2026 and is expected to reach USD 129.2 billion by 2033, growing at a compound annual growth rate (CAGR) of 6.1% from 2026 to 2033. This significant growth reflects rising demand for aircraft maintenance, repair, and overhaul services driven by expanding commercial aviation fleets and increasing defense budgets globally. The market's steady expansion highlights the critical role of MRO services in ensuring safety, operational efficiency, and regulatory compliance within the aerospace and defense sectors.

A key market trend shaping the Aerospace and Defense MRO industry is the growing integration of advanced technologies such as predictive maintenance, artificial intelligence, and digital twins. These innovations enhance maintenance efficiency, reduce downtime, and lower overall operational costs. Additionally, the rise of sustainable aviation initiatives is pushing MRO providers to develop eco-friendly repair and overhaul processes. Increasing collaborations between OEMs and service providers are also fostering more comprehensive and customized MRO solutions, further driving market adoption and growth.

Segmental Analysis:

By Service Type: Line Maintenance Leading Due to Operational Necessity and Quick Turnaround Demands

In terms of By Service Type, Line Maintenance contributes the highest share of the Aerospace and Defense MRO Market owing to its critical role in ensuring daily operational reliability and safety of aircraft. Line maintenance generally comprises routine checks and minor repairs conducted between flights, which are essential to maintain uninterrupted flight schedules, reduce downtime, and comply with stringent regulatory requirements. Airlines and other operators prioritize line maintenance because it directly affects aircraft availability, making it indispensable for the commercial aviation sector's fast-paced operational environment. The increasing demand for efficient turnaround times at airports, combined with the growing number of daily flights globally, has intensified the need for robust line maintenance services. Furthermore, advancements in diagnostic technologies and predictive maintenance have enhanced the efficiency and precision of line maintenance activities, thus reducing costs associated with unscheduled delays and cancellations. This segment benefits from continuous investments in workforce training and infrastructure to handle diverse aircraft types and complex systems, ensuring adherence to stringent safety standards. The recurring nature of line maintenance also guarantees a stable revenue stream for service providers and supports long-term partnerships with airlines. Additionally, regulatory pressure from aviation authorities worldwide mandates regular line inspections and timely remediation of detected issues, reinforcing the growth of this segment.

By Platform Type: Commercial Aircraft Dominance Driven by High Fleet Volume and Service Frequency

In terms of By Platform Type, Commercial Aircraft contribute the highest share of the Aerospace and Defense MRO Market as a result of their predominance in global air traffic and the extensive size of their fleets. Commercial aircraft operate on frequent, scheduled routes, necessitating constant and meticulous maintenance to ensure flight safety and minimize operational disruptions. The sheer number of commercial aircraft in service internationally significantly elevates the demand for comprehensive MRO services, including line, heavy, engine, and component maintenance. The increasing passenger traffic and expansion of low-cost carriers propel fleet growth, leading to higher maintenance requirements and complexity. Regulatory mandates for stringent airworthiness checks, especially for wide-body and narrow-body commercial aircraft, further emphasize the role of maintenance providers in sustaining fleet health. Moreover, the shift toward more fuel-efficient and technologically advanced commercial aircraft models has fostered innovation in MRO solutions, including predictive maintenance and modular repairs, which enhance operational efficiency. The intricate supply chain associated with commercial aviation, involving OEMs, third-party providers, and airlines, creates a vibrant ecosystem that supports continuous investments in this segment. This dynamic ensures that commercial aircraft maintenance remains the largest platform segment, given the critical need to maintain safety, reliability, and operational availability in a highly competitive and regulated industry.

By End User: Airlines Lead Owing to Their Fleet Scale and Operational Maintenance Requirements

In terms of By End User, Airlines command the largest share of the Aerospace and Defense MRO Market attributable to their vast fleets and the ongoing need to maintain aircraft in optimal condition to preserve service reliability and passenger safety. Airlines represent the primary operators of commercial aircraft, necessitating a broad spectrum of MRO activities ranging from routine inspections to extensive overhauls across their diverse fleet portfolios. The operational efficiency of airlines is heavily reliant on prompt and effective maintenance services to prevent disruptions and uphold schedules, which drives constant demand for MRO capabilities. Additionally, competition within the airline industry to reduce turnaround times and maintenance downtime boosts investment in innovative maintenance technologies and outsourcing strategies that improve asset utilization and cost control. Airlines also face stringent regulatory oversight requiring adherence to detailed maintenance programs covering airframe, engine, and component upkeep, which further increases their demand for specialized MRO providers. Many airlines adopt strategic partnerships or in-house maintenance units, which reflect their critical role as end users shaping the market landscape. The expansion of international travel, combined with increasing environmental regulations, compels airlines to invest in advanced engine and component maintenance techniques aimed at enhancing fuel efficiency and reducing emissions. Collectively, these factors sustain airlines as the dominant end-user segment, driving volume and innovation within the Aerospace and Defense MRO market.

Regional Insights:

Dominating Region: North America

In North America, the dominance in the Aerospace and Defense MRO (Maintenance, Repair, and Overhaul) Market is driven by a highly developed aerospace ecosystem, significant defense spending, and strong government support. The United States, hosting major aerospace hubs, benefits from the presence of leading defense contractors and commercial aircraft manufacturers such as Boeing, Lockheed Martin, and Raytheon Technologies, which heavily invest in MRO capabilities. Additionally, the region's regulatory environment, with agencies like the FAA and Department of Defense fostering stringent maintenance standards, ensures steady demand for advanced MRO services. The integration of innovative technologies such as predictive maintenance and digital twins further strengthens the market. Furthermore, North America's extensive network of airports and military bases supports a continuous need for timely and comprehensive MRO services, reinforcing its position as the dominant region.

Fastest-Growing Region: Asia Pacific

Meanwhile, Asia Pacific exhibits the fastest growth in the Aerospace and Defense MRO Market owing to rapid expansion in commercial aviation, increasing defense budgets, and improving infrastructure. The region benefits from rising air passenger traffic and growing fleets of aging aircraft requiring maintenance. Countries like China and India are focusing on becoming aerospace manufacturing and MRO hubs, supported by government initiatives such as "Make in India" and China's "Made in China 2025" plan, which emphasize self-reliance and technological advancement. Additionally, partnerships between local and international MRO service providers are expanding capacity and expertise throughout the region. Strategically positioned airports and favorable trade policies have enhanced regional supply chains, enabling efficient MRO operations. Notable companies contributing to this growth include Singapore Technologies Engineering, China Aviation Oil, and HCL Technologies, which offer a range of MRO services and are investing in technological innovation to capture this growing market.

Aerospace and Defense MRO Market Outlook for Key Countries

United States

The United States' market is characterized by a vast network of aerospace and defense manufacturers and service providers, reinforcing its global leadership. Industry giants like Boeing, Lockheed Martin, and Honeywell maintain comprehensive MRO facilities, supported by extensive R&D efforts to incorporate cutting-edge technologies such as AI-based predictive maintenance and autonomous inspection drones. The U.S. government's robust defense expenditure ensures a steady pipeline of military aircraft maintenance, while the commercial aviation market's maturity drives continuous innovation in MRO processes. This blend of defense and commercial aviation needs makes the U.S. a powerhouse in the MRO landscape.

China

China's evolving aerospace MRO market is propelled by the country's strategic push towards enhancing domestic aerospace capabilities and expanding its commercial aircraft fleet. The presence of significant players such as China Aviation Oil and AVIC Commercial Aircraft Engine Co. bolsters the MRO ecosystem, while government policies emphasize technology transfer and localization to build self-sufficiency. China's rapidly modernizing military also demands extensive maintenance support, fueling market growth. Collaborations with international firms bring advanced MRO expertise and facilitate knowledge exchange, aiding China's transition into a competitive aerospace MRO center.

India

India's aerospace and defense MRO market is gaining momentum with a strong governmental focus on indigenization and infrastructure development. Initiatives like the "Make in India" campaign encourage both foreign and domestic investment in MRO facilities, aligned with a growing commercial aviation sector that demands improved maintenance capabilities. Companies like Air Works and HCL Technologies have emerged as key contributors by providing innovative MRO solutions, including digital and automated services. Defense modernization further complements commercial market growth, making India a dynamic emerging player with expanding service capacities.

United Kingdom

The United Kingdom continues to lead in aerospace MRO through its established aerospace manufacturing base and specialist service providers. The presence of companies such as BAE Systems and Rolls-Royce ensures strong capabilities in defense and commercial aircraft maintenance. The UK's MRO sector benefits from government initiatives to support aerospace innovation, including investment in green technologies and digital transformation. Access to global supply chains and a skilled workforce underpin the market, while strategic partnerships and defense contracts enable sustained growth in both military and civil aviation sectors.

Singapore

Singapore's aerospace and defense MRO market is a critical hub within Asia Pacific, leveraging its strategic geographic location and world-class infrastructure. Companies like ST Engineering Aerospace offer comprehensive MRO services, ranging from engine overhaul to avionics upgrades, serving both regional and international clients. The government's proactive aerospace policies, including the development of aerospace parks and incentives for technology investments, create an attractive environment for MRO operators. Trade-friendly regulations and a strong focus on innovation support Singapore's emergence as a leading MRO center in the fast-growing Asia Pacific market.
